
Ce week-end, j’ai réalisé que le développement assisté par l’IA est en train de bouleverser l’Open Source bien plus que je ne le pensais.
Fan d’Open Source et de logiciel libre (on ne passe pas 17 ans sur le projet Mozilla comme ça), je vois un ami, Pablo Pernot développer seul avec une IA un réseau social professionnel, Ponos-Jobs, concurrent de LinkedIn.
J’ignore encore à quel point le projet sera un succès, mais je découvre qu’il est open source et que son auteur affirme “comme c’est codé par une IA, ça n’a pas d’importance”. Et ça m’intrigue bigrement !
Pour moi, un logiciel libre / Open source est intrinsèquement meilleur qu’un logiciel propriétaire, parce que le code est libre et ouvert, et que donc je suis beaucoup moins dépendant de son auteur.
Et là, pourquoi le fait que ça soit généré par IA fait que la nature open-source du projet n’importe plus ? Parce que l’IA, avec sa capacité à générer rapidement beaucoup de code, travaille très différemment des humains.
Une communauté d’humains qui écrit du code, c’est à la main, petit à petit, comme des maçons qui monteraient un mur brique par brique. Si un bout du logiciel est défectueux, alors on peut le changer, le remplacer, le corriger. Un humain qui n’aime pas telle ou telle fonctionnalité va remplir un rapport (une “issue”, en anglais) pour suggérer un changement. Et quelqu’un qui travaille déjà sur le projet va regarder cette “issue”, essayer de comprendre ce que veut la personne, si ça a du sens. L’auteur de “l’issue” peut aussi proposer un bout de code alternatif qui pourrait répondre à son besoin, façon “mets ce code à la place du tien, ça résout le problème”. C’est comme ça qu’on bâtit en même temps un logiciel de meilleure qualité et une communauté de contributeurs.
Mais avec l’IA, le changement est énorme : quelques lignes de “prompt” suffisent à lancer la machine qui va ignorer l’existant et réécrire tout un module. L’IA ne va pas changer une brique dans un mur, elle va faire un tout nouveau mur en béton. Qu’on jettera si nécessaire puisqu’il est si facile de refaire tout un mur avec l’IA.
Alors certes, on va plus vite, mais on ne construit plus de communauté. On efface l’essentiel des humains de l’équation. Reste juste le contributeur principal, tout seul. Mais augmenté par une IA.
Qu’arrivera-t-il quand il se lassera de ce projet ? Dans une communauté, on arrive à faire émerger des gens qui veulent reprendre le projet quand c’est nécessaire, mais là, avec l’IA, ce ne sera plus le cas.
Et vous, que pensez-vous de l’arrivée de l’IA dans les projets open source et de logiciels libres ?


8 réactions
1 De Franck - 27/01/2026, 12:55
Tu as raison pour l’aspect communautaire humain, et c’est une part importante du plaisir de l’open-source, l’échange avec autrui.
Maintenant pour nuancer, l’IA peut fournir un coup de main pour des trucs rébarbatifs du genre : préparer un squelette de tests unitaires ou fonctionnels par exemple. Et également pour gérer l’aspect traduction (tout le monde n’est pas polyglotte voire anglophone).
2 De karl - 27/01/2026, 14:06
La grande majorité des projets opensource n’ont pas de communautés. Et ceux qui ont des communautés les ont déjà.
En revanche, l’IA apporte aussi la possibilité de montée en compétences, l’élimination des trucs rébarbatifs comme le dit Frank, la documentation du projet opensource et même la possibilité de mieux comprendre un code sans avoir un bourru qui ignore toute question en te répondant, tu n’as qu’à envoyer une PR. Il faut aussi ne pas trop donner une image bisounours du monde opensource. Il y a des communautés sympas et d’autres vraiment désagréables ou même dans un seul projet des sections de code qui sont gérées par un abruti et une autre section par quelqu’un de formidable.
L’humain est toujours là. Il suffit d’utiliser l’outil dans ce sens, comme tous les outils des générations précédentes.
3 De mart-e - 27/01/2026, 14:36
Dans les alternatives à linkedin, tu as https://nolto.social/ (https://codeberg.org/Tensetti/Nolto)
ah ben, je pense que tu as raison…
4 De Ant - 27/01/2026, 15:18
Bonjour,
Nolto, cela a l’air très bien.
Mais je viens d’essayer de créer un compte, et ça marche pô !
J’ai regardé, le lien de confirmation d’inscription n’est pas valable, il semble buggué.
et idem pour le reste de la mécanique de login,…
Le code ne semble pas avoir été mis à jour depuis 7 ou 8 mois.
=> svp, question : le réseau et le service sont actifs ?
ou plus ?
Il semble que ce soit pour les inscriptions par adresse email.
Pour les inscription par compte fediverse, (mastodon), cela semble fonctionner.
Svp, vous pouvez confirmer cela ?
5 De Tristan - 27/01/2026, 18:15
oui, j’aurais du parler de Nolto aussi. J’y ai un compte, j’ai utilisé Masto pour me loguer.
6 De cdg - 28/01/2026, 15:22
Je suis pas sur qu on puisse reellement faire un produit complet avec de l IA. J ai un ami qui a fait un programme pour gerer son club d alpinisme via IA. Ca a l air de bien marcher mais c est un CRUD assez basique
Les problemes avec l IA sont :
- difficile de faire une modification du code, comme vous l ecrivez on regenere tout. Mais avec le meme prompt vous allez avoir un autre resultat 6 mois plus tard et a mon avis les prompt son meme pas sauvegardés
- qui est responsable en cas de probleme ? pour l open source c est clair (utilisation a vos risque et peril). mais pour un produit commercial ca va etre complique d expliquer que si l avion s est ecrasé ou la voiture n a pas freine c est a cause de chatgpt … Meme en cas de fuite de donnee car le code genere a laisse une breche (genre injection sql ou BD mal configuree) ca va etre chaud
apres c est clair que vu les economies en se debarassant des developpeurs on avoir de plus en plus de produit fait par IA (sur youtube les video IA proliferent, je vois pas comment eviter la meme chose sur app store)
7 De barijaona - 28/01/2026, 16:53
Merci pour ce texte.
Je me suis inspiré d’une partie de celui-ci pour ébaucher un projet de règles de fonctionnement pour une application que je contribue à maintenir.
https://github.com/ViennaRSS/vienna…
Avis bienvenus, sur Github ou ici.
8 De Aignan - 31/01/2026, 13:56
Bonjour Tristan. Ces derniers temps, je n’arrive plus du tout à vous suivre; un jour vous critiquez l’IA et les consommations énergétiques insoutenables liées, un autre vous faites la promotion d’un outil entièrement vibe-codé avec Claude Code, produit propriétaire d’une société américaine… Je comprends qu’on soit tous plus ou moins victime de dissonance cognitive et moi le premier, mais là le grand écart est impressionnant. Vous nous posez la question de ce que l’on pense de l’arrivée de l’IA dans l’open source, j’ai surtout envie voire besoin de savoir ce que vous, vous en pensez. Encore une fois je comprends qu’on puisse changer d’avis sur un sujet aussi complexe, mais aussi régulièrement, aussi souvent, de façon aussi antagoniste d’un jour à l’autre ? Mettez-vous un peu à notre place, ça n’aide pas beaucoup ) nous rassurer ni à y voir plus clair, bien au contraire :)